James's priorities if elected:

My top priority is the development and safety of Austintown Township and the safety of its residents. My vision for the development and growth of the township is set in a three tier system. 1. Business Development: It is essential to the growth of Austintown to bring viable businesses to the community. As a community leader I will take an interest in all existing and new businesses and their operations. My desire is to quickly occupy vacant buildings and store fronts and develop empty areas within the township. I would like to see the creation of a township website addressing all available/ vacant business locations for sale and lease. With the use of this website, by working with area real estate companies and the property owners, and it’s easy accessibility to major interstates, Austintown Township should be a hot spot for retail and service businesses. 2. Public Safety and Security: A safer community is not achieved by reacting to issues as they occur, it means continuing the proactive approach the Austintown Police Department and Fire Department are already taking. My 9 year background as a member of Mahoning Valley Law Enforcement will also help me identify successful strategies for addressing issues of crime prevention and community safety. By developing a plan comprised of input from the township’s leaders, our safety forces, our citizens, and neighboring communities we can be sure the safety of our loved ones, preservation of our properties, and security of our community will not be compromised. I would like to see a plan developed to restore a reserve police core to assist the full time officers and enable more enforcement in high profile/ high risk areas of the township. I fully support the continuance of application for grant money by the fire and police departments to obtain equipment, employment, and training for their employees. 3.Parks and Recreation: Parks are an important part of community life. While it may be challenging to overcome funding issues it is my goal to communicate the importance of parks and recreation by continuing park programs and developing new ones. It is my desire to explore all resources such as having neighborhoods take an active interest in the parks such as assisting with certain maintenance, suggesting ideas for improvements, talking to children about the importance of parks, and making sure our parks continue to be an attractive asset to the community. By developing Austintown businesses, ensuring public safety, and creating programs and activities for Austintown residents I know that Austintown will be a community that it’s residents and neighboring communities respect.
